Serving Bishopsgarth and Teesside

Teesside covers the urban centres of Middlesbrough, Stockton, and Darlington along with surrounding market towns and coastal communities. The area's housing stock ranges from Victorian terraces in established neighbourhoods to modern developments on the outskirts and coastal properties along the North Sea.

Stockton-on-Tees sits on the River Tees with a wide Georgian high street and a mix of Victorian, inter-war, and modern housing. The town is well-connected to Middlesbrough and Darlington, with popular suburbs like Norton, Hartburn, and Fairfield.

How Your Roofing Project Works in Bishopsgarth

We've completed multiple projects in this area recently and can provide local references on request.

1

Free Roof Survey

We inspect your roof from ladder and loft, checking tiles, flashings, gutters, and timber condition.

2

Detailed Report

A comprehensive report with photographs is provided alongside a transparent, fixed-price quotation.

3

Scaffold Erection

Scaffolding is positioned carefully to protect your driveway and garden during the project.

4

Roof Installation

Tiles, membrane, fascias, soffits, and guttering are renewed or repaired to a high standard.

5

Final Inspection

We inspect the completed roof, clear all waste, and hand over your guarantee documentation.
